About Purdom Pikes

Purdom Pikes is a mountain summit in the Carlisle to Kielder and the North Tyne region in the county of Northumberland, England. Purdom Pikes is 454 metres high with a prominence of 45 metres. Purdom Pikes Summit Stats

Height in Metres: 454 metres

Height in Feet: 1489 feet

Range: Carlisle to Kielder and the North Tyne

Prominence: 45 metres

Parent Summit: Larriston Fells

Grid Reference: NY605919

Col Height: 409

Col Grid Reference: NY592920

Summit Classification: 4

National Park, County or Country: Carlisle to Kielder and the North Tyne, England’s Highest Mountains, Hills in Northumberland

Recommended Maps: Landranger Map 80   Explorer Map OL42W
